What are the key technical specifications to consider when sourcing electric metal shears for industrial use?
When evaluating electric metal shears, the most critical specification is the cutting capacity, typically measured in millimeters for stainless steel and carbon steel. You should prioritize tools with a high-torque motor (500W-700W) to ensure clean cuts without stalling. Additionally, look for a high stroke rate (strokes per minute) to improve efficiency and replaceable high-alloy steel blades that maintain sharpness over long-term use. For ergonomic safety, ensure the tool features a 360-degree swiveling head to allow for versatile cutting angles.
Which international compliance standards and certifications are mandatory for importing electric metal shears?
To ensure product safety and legal entry into global markets, the shears must carry the CE Marking for the European Union or UL/ETL certification for North America. Since these are motorized tools, compliance with the Machinery Directive 2006/42/EC and RoHS (Restriction of Hazardous Substances) is essential. For battery-operated cordless models, verify UN38.3 certification for safe lithium battery transport and MSDS (Material Safety Data Sheet) documentation.
How can a buyer verify the durability and performance of the shears before placing a bulk order?
Request a third-party inspection report focusing on the hardness of the cutting head (HRC 58-62) and a continuous load test to check for motor overheating. It is highly recommended to order a pre-shipment sample to test the 'burr-free' quality of the cut on your specific metal gauges. What are the common usage scenarios and functional differences between nibblers and shears?
Buyers must distinguish between Electric Shears, which remove a thin strip of waste and are best for straight lines and large curves, and Nibblers, which 'punch' out small pieces and are ideal for tight radiuses and corrugated materials. For HVAC and roofing applications, double-cut shears are preferred as they minimize material distortion, whereas single-cut shears are faster for heavy-gauge flat sheets.

What are the primary risks when sourcing industrial power tools from overseas suppliers?
The main risks include voltage incompatibility (e.g., 110V vs 220V) and plug type mismatches. Always specify the destination country's electrical standards in the contract. Another risk is inadequate packaging, which can lead to calibration issues or motor damage during maritime transit; ensure the supplier uses custom-fit blow-molded cases and moisture-proof inner lining.

What logistics and shipping methods are best for heavy electric metal shears?
For small trial orders, International Express (DHL/FedEx) is fastest but expensive due to weight. For bulk commercial stock, LCL (Less than Container Load) Sea Freight is the most cost-effective. If purchasing cordless models, be aware that Lithium batteries are classified as Class 9 Dangerous Goods, requiring specialized couriers and higher shipping premiums compared to corded versions.
